Is Sermorelin FDA Approved
Compounded sermorelin acetate is not directly FDA-approved as a standalone drug for general use. Instead, it is a GHRH analog that is legally compounded by pharmacies under sections 503A and 503B of the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. These sections allow for the preparation of customized medications based on a physician’s prescription when a patient has a medical need for it.
What Is The Difference Between Sermorelin And GHRPs
While both are peptides that stimulate GH release, sermorelin is a GHRH analog that directly signals the pituitary gland. Growth Hormone Releasing Peptides (GHRPs), like Ipamorelin or GHRP-6, act on different pathways, also influencing GH secretion. Often, these peptides are used in combination to achieve a more significant and sustained increase in growth hormone levels.
